Bioactivity | Triclacetamol is the trichloroacetyl derivative of Acetaminophen (HY-66005), exhibiting weak cyclooxygenase inhibition and possessing analgesic and antipyretic activities as a n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ID). Triclacetamol acts as an anti-inflammatory agent and promotes the excretion of uric acid[1]. |
CAS | 6340-87-0 |
Formula | C8H6Cl3NO2 |
Molar Mass | 254.50 |
